What is 100% in Pokemon GO?

A 100% IV would mean that Attack, Defense and Stamina are all at 15. Everything below that works out to being a percentage of the maximum possible stat of 45. For example: A Gengar with 10 Attack, 10 Defense and 12 Stamina would have an IV of 71%. In other words, 71% of 45.

What does 100% mean in Pokémon GO?

A Pokémon with 15 of each is perfect, and it has the highest CP, attack damage, HP, and Defense for that species of Pokémon. They're rare but worth checking for! You can check for "100%" Pokémon using the game's appraisal system. If it gets the best appraisal possible, then it's perfect.

What are 100% odds in Pokémon GO?

The chance to get a 100% IV (15/15/15) Pokémon in Pokémon GO is 1/4096, or in percentage, 0.0244%. The chance to get any combination of IVs is the same and equals 1/4096.

How do you get 100 percent Pokémon in Pokémon GO?

Hatching Pokemon from eggs, earning them in quests or defeating them as a Raid Boss all provide the same chance of obtaining a 100 IV Pokemon – 1 in 216. That is because each stat is guaranteed to be 10 or more. Pokemon hatched from eggs will have a minimum of 10 IVs across the board…

What is a 4 star Pokemon GO?

4 stars is one hundred percent ivs. Hundo is common slang for one hundred, therefore 4 stars is a hundo. You do whatever you want with them. 4 stars iv doesn't make them better than other pokemon, their base stats and moves do, so they aren't always useful, just the highest ivs of their species.

How rare are 0 Pokémon in Pokemon go?

However 0% pokemon are even rarer than 100% pokemon, since the former can never come from raids, eggs, research tasks or trades. I have a 0% Houndour and Sandshrew. I wish i'd thought of collecting them at an earlier date, i've probably binned one or two 0% pidgeys without knowing.

What is the 3 * in Pokemon GO?

Getting a 3-star ranking with a red emblem means that your Pokémon's IVs are perfect, while 3 stars with a gold emblem indicate IVs that are around 82% to 98% perfect.

Is higher CP or stars better in Pokemon GO?

Rating stars represent the potential, and CP represents the current state. If you power up a Pokemon with 3 stats to the same level as a 0 star Pokemon of the same species, the 3 star one will have more CP. Usually CP is your best indicator of your strongest fighters (but there are TONS more factors).

How do you catch a ditto?

In order to find Ditto, you'll want to find the Pokémon that it currently disguises itself as. For example, you may see a Diglett, and it'll stay a Diglett once you tap on it, but it's secretly a Ditto. Once you catch that Pokémon, you'll be met with an “Oh?” prompt, and it'll turn into a Ditto — if you're lucky.

What is a 1 star Pokémon?

Two stars means 66-80% IVs and one star means 50-65% IVs. Each tick of the stat bar is five stat points, so you can eyeball it out and see how good your Pokémon's individual values are.

Is PVP IV important?

All you need to know is that because of it, the attack stat and IV have a significantly larger impact on the Pokemon's CP than its defense and HP stats/IVs. However, in actual battles, it's often – but not always – the case that all three stats are more or less equally valuable.
